Charbone Begins Phase 1B Construction at Sorel-Tracy, Installs Metrology Equipment for Hydrogen Purity Testing

Charbone Corporation (TSXV: CH; OTCQB: CHHYF; FSE: K47), a vertically integrated industrial gases company, announced on July 7, 2026, that it has started Phase 1B civil construction at its clean ultra-high purity (UHP) hydrogen plant in Sorel-Tracy, Quebec. The company also announced the installation of a gas chromatography system for on-site batch purity testing of its hydrogen, with the goal of making upgraded production capacity operational by fall.

Heavy civil construction equipment has arrived on-site, and Charbone’s general contractor and subcontractor teams have begun work. Surveyors have completed all necessary site markings for the construction of production areas, in preparation for the arrival of production equipment in the coming weeks and the construction of the operation and maintenance building. This marks the official initiation of the Phase 1B construction stage, which includes readying the technological infrastructure and placing foundational structures required for subsequent assembly of primary equipment.

In a separate development, a cutting-edge gas chromatography system has been deployed by a world-renowned firm, a leader in life sciences, diagnostics, and applied markets. The system is specifically engineered for high-purity hydrogen analysis, designed to identify traces of impurities and guarantee purity gas compliance with relevant standards. This will allow Charbone to easily access its stringent purity benchmarks, aiming to enhance sales among customers requiring effective testing solutions.

The Phase 1B expansion is part of Charbone’s broader strategy to develop a network of clean UHP hydrogen production facilities across North America and selected international markets. The company’s modular, decentralized, and demand-driven approach, combined with its integrated storage and distribution platform for all UHP gases, supports scalable growth and operational flexibility. Charbone serves customers in sectors such as semiconductors, artificial intelligence and data centers, advanced pharmaceuticals, and aerospace and defense, where UHP gases are critical for high-precision manufacturing.
